Removing and installing O-rings for unit injector |
Special tools and workshop equipment required |
t
| Assembling sleeves -T10056- |
–
| Lever off the O-rings from the grooves of the unit injector with extreme care. |
–
| Make sure, above all, that the contact surfaces in the grooves for the O-rings are not damaged. |
Note t
| Always use the assembly sleeves to install the O-rings. If they are not used there is a risk that the O-rings may become damaged. |
t
| Observe the correct allocation of the O-rings to the slots: the ring thickness reduces in the direction of the injection nozzle. |
t
| Avoid rolling the O-rings when sliding them on. The O-rings must not be turned inwards on the groove of the unit injector. |
–
| Remove the heat-protection seal along with the circlip. |
–
| Clean the contact surfaces for the O-rings in the grooves of the unit injector with great care. |
